Management of 24-Year-Old with Fatty Liver Disease and Persistently Elevated Transaminases
Referral to gastroenterology should be considered for persistently elevated or worsening transaminases in this young patient with documented fatty liver disease. 1
Immediate Next Steps
Complete the Diagnostic Evaluation
Obtain a comprehensive metabolic and viral hepatitis panel including fasting glucose or HbA1c, fasting lipid profile, hepatitis B surface antigen, hepatitis C antibody, iron studies (ferritin and transferrin saturation), thyroid function tests, and creatine kinase to exclude secondary causes 1, 2, 3
Assess for metabolic syndrome components by measuring waist circumference, blood pressure, and evaluating for obesity, diabetes, hypertension, and dyslipidemia, as these are critical risk factors for nonalcoholic fatty liver disease progression 1, 2, 4
Conduct a detailed medication and supplement review checking all substances against the LiverTox® database, as medication-induced liver injury accounts for 8-11% of cases with elevated liver enzymes 2, 3
Obtain detailed alcohol consumption history including quantification of drinks per week, as even moderate alcohol consumption (9-20 g daily) can double the risk for adverse liver-related outcomes in NAFLD patients 1
Risk Stratification for Advanced Fibrosis
Calculate the FIB-4 score using age, ALT, AST, and platelet count to determine the risk of advanced fibrosis and need for hepatology referral 1, 2, 5
- A FIB-4 score >2.67 indicates high risk for advanced fibrosis and warrants hepatology referral 1, 2, 5
- A FIB-4 score <1.3 has a negative predictive value ≥90% for excluding advanced fibrosis 2
Order abdominal ultrasound as the first-line imaging modality, which has 84.8% sensitivity and 93.6% specificity for detecting moderate to severe hepatic steatosis and can identify biliary obstruction or focal liver lesions 1, 2, 5
Clinical Significance of These Transaminase Levels
The AST and ALT levels of 134 IU/L represent moderate elevation (approximately 3-4× upper limit of normal for this age group), which is concerning in a 24-year-old patient 2, 5, 6
- This degree of elevation in a young patient with fatty liver disease suggests possible nonalcoholic steatohepatitis (NASH) rather than simple steatosis 1, 7
- The equal elevation of AST and ALT (ratio of 1:1) is consistent with NAFLD, as alcoholic liver disease typically shows AST:ALT ratio >2 1, 2, 5
- Persistently elevated transaminases in youth with type 2 diabetes or metabolic syndrome warrant more aggressive evaluation due to higher complication risk and earlier cardiovascular morbidity compared to adult-onset disease 1
Immediate Management Interventions
Lifestyle Modifications (Cornerstone of Treatment)
Implement aggressive lifestyle changes targeting 7-10% weight loss through caloric restriction, as this is the most effective intervention for NAFLD 1, 2, 4
Prescribe 150-300 minutes of moderate-intensity aerobic exercise weekly (50-70% of maximal heart rate), as physical activity decreases steatosis even without significant weight loss 1, 2, 4
Recommend a low-carbohydrate, low-fructose diet limiting calories from fat to 25-30%, saturated fat to <7%, and avoiding trans fats 1, 2
Mandate complete alcohol abstinence, as any alcohol consumption can exacerbate liver injury and impede recovery in NAFLD patients 1, 2
Metabolic Comorbidity Management
Aggressively treat all metabolic syndrome components including dyslipidemia with statins (which are safe in NAFLD), optimize glycemic control if diabetic, and manage hypertension per standard guidelines 1, 4
- Statins have beneficial pleiotropic properties and are recommended by current guidelines for NAFLD patients with dyslipidemia 1
- If diabetic, consider GLP-1 receptor agonists or SGLT2 inhibitors, which improve cardiometabolic profile and reverse steatosis 1, 4
Monitoring Strategy
Repeat liver function tests in 2-4 weeks to establish trend and assess response to initial interventions 2, 5
- If ALT increases to >5× ULN (>165 IU/L for males, >125 IU/L for females) or bilirubin >2× ULN, urgent hepatology referral is required 1, 2, 5
- If ALT remains elevated but stable, continue monitoring every 4-8 weeks until normalized or stabilized 2
- Annual screening for NAFLD complications including evaluation for nonalcoholic fatty liver disease by measuring AST and ALT annually 1
When to Refer to Gastroenterology/Hepatology
Immediate referral is indicated if: 1, 2, 5
- Transaminases remain persistently elevated or worsen despite lifestyle modifications
- ALT increases to >5× ULN (>235 IU/L)
- Evidence of synthetic dysfunction (elevated bilirubin, prolonged PT/INR, low albumin)
- FIB-4 score >2.67 indicating high risk for advanced fibrosis
- Transaminases remain elevated for ≥6 months without identified cause
Important Considerations for This Young Patient
Youth-onset metabolic liver disease carries significantly higher risk for cardiovascular morbidity and mortality at an earlier age than adult-onset disease, making aggressive intervention critical 1
- The 24-year-old age makes secondary causes less likely but still requires exclusion of Wilson disease, autoimmune hepatitis, and hereditary hemochromatosis 1, 2, 8
- Normal ALT does not exclude significant liver disease, as up to 10% of patients with advanced fibrosis can have normal ALT using conventional thresholds 2, 7
- Approximately 37.5% of NAFLD patients with normal ALT can still have NASH or advanced fibrosis, emphasizing the importance of risk stratification beyond transaminase levels alone 7
Common Pitfalls to Avoid
- Do not assume these elevations are benign simply because the patient is young; NASH patients can have significant disease progression over relatively short periods 9
- Do not delay evaluation waiting for higher transaminase levels, as fibrosis progression may be irreversible without specific interventions 9
- Do not overlook the importance of complete alcohol cessation, as even moderate consumption significantly impacts outcomes 1, 2
- Do not use commercial laboratory "normal" ranges for ALT; use sex-specific cutoffs (>33 IU/L for males, >25 IU/L for females) to better identify clinically significant liver disease 2, 4, 5
